Hey everybody.
Im have a Prepaid Softbank phone number. So far I've managed to find out that Text messages (SMS) do not work internationally (can not send or receive) and that they use emails.
I've topped up my account with 3000 JPY (minmum), Im using S-mail to communicate with people sometimes. I have to topup my account every 2 months with 3000JPY in order for the number to still work.
My problem is: I AM NOT spending 3000JPY, but much much less. So every 2-3 months I have 2000JPY more on my account. Money which I am throwing away.
Is there any way to get this money back or can I use my phone to pay for something? Any way to spend this extra prepaid ballance funds?

Oh, and you can text/sms, but only other softbank users.
if you talk to the staff next time you go to the store, ask them. Its a 300 yen fee for texting, so at least that will use up some of that lost money.
